
CONBRAN 2024

São Paulo, the largest Brazilian capital, will host the largest Nutrition event in Latin America in 2024. The city, which reproduces the diversity of flavors, aromas, cultures and races, will host the 28th edition of the Brazilian Nutrition Congress – CONBRAN, whose theme will be “Food and Nutrition from the perspective of comprehensive care practices”.

Lifestyles, dietary patterns and health impacts
Dietary patterns are directly linked to food systems and environments, and are determinants and conditions of health status throughout the life course. The different forms of malnutrition and food insecurity are complex problems today and represent important challenges for nutritional care.

Collective feeding and food and nutritional security
Institutional and commercial food and nutrition spaces are essential for health care and commensality, in which quality, safety, management and sustainability are fundamental aspects.
